Output 34e9b07e55911519c593826f1e3aff29c291cc5d8a7cc828fb9c3840e14ff6b8:0

value
329780
script pubkey
OP_0 OP_PUSHBYTES_20 e8f6b7f030c3954236cb332e41cb053da5a42866
address
bc1qarmt0upscw25ydktxvhyrjc98kj6g2rxcczdk4
transaction
34e9b07e55911519c593826f1e3aff29c291cc5d8a7cc828fb9c3840e14ff6b8
confirmations
68509
spent
true